    Interesting to watch as a non Singaporean. One thing I can say is that for a global financial/commerce hub HDB property prices are definitely low. Low/Middle class struggles much more to pay for rent in London, HK or NY than in SG. One difference though is that in Europe or US people with low/medium income can choose to live in smaller cities / countryside to get better standard of living (even a landed property). Singaporeans do not really have this option.

    I believe the recent cooling measures is the govt aims to curb the million dollar property. Hence the 15 month wait for HDB resale flat buyers. Previously private owners would sell their house, and purchase larger units (5 room). This pushes the many 5 room flat to the million dollar mark.
